Covid-19 cases decline for three weeks in a row in Mexico

covid-19-cases-decline-for-three-weeks-in-a-row-in-mexico
Mexico, Feb 15 (Prensa Latina) Mexico reached the third consecutive week of reduction of Covid-19, with figures above 40 percent and even the last one of 48, informed today the Undersecretary of Health, Hugo Lopez-Gatell.

Speaking at the morning press conference at the National Palace, the official explained that the intensity of incidence of new cases is below previous levels, and only 1.6 percent are active, compared to 8.9 which was the maximum reached in the current fourth wave.

In terms of optimizing treatment of the pandemic, he noted, there has been a clear reduction in hospitalization with fewer people being treated per available bed. Mortality is also decreasing with a sustained trend in the 32 federal entities, including the capital.

Regarding children and adolescents, as mentioned above, the upturn was not due to school attendance, since it occurred during the holiday period at the beginning of winter. Only 0.12 percent of the schools were affected and were temporarily closed, a minimal number.

He informed that they continue to vaccinate all age groups without leaving anyone behind, especially the coverage in the most remote areas of the country and we insist with people who refuse to get vaccinated and we show them the importance of doing so because this is a fourth wave of sick people who have not been vaccinated.

For his part, President Andrés Manuel López Obrador was pleased with the participation of the people that made Mexico rank ninth in the world out of nearly 200 countries, and 25th in deaths, below Italy and Brazil.
